Episode Synopsis "State Of The Artist: A Slippery Floor & A Radiator -- A Perfect Combination"
The first time I met Nate Woogen, I didn't actually meet the man, I met the man's writing, specifically a scene from his screenplay, "Physical Therapy Massacre." I saw actors performing it at a cold reading presented by Naked Angels.
